Software Integration Engineer

The Software Integration Engineer shall be responsible for the installation, configuration, maintenance, and troubleshooting of a large-scale multi-tenant Kubernetes "on-prem" cluster which serves as the foundation for mission-critical applications across multiple tenants. In this role, the Software Integration Engineer shall collaborate closely with DevOps, Security, and Application teams to implement automation, enforce best practices, and support integration of new services within the Kubernetes cluster ensuring the reliability, performance, and security of the Kubernetes-based infrastructure.

Required Education, Experience, & Skills

Position Required Skills:

  • Experience with Linux CLI
  • Experience writing scripts using Bash/Python
  • Experience troubleshooting and resolving issues related to Kubernetes workloads, networking, ingress, storage, and performance
  • Experience with containerization technologies such as Docker
  • Demonstrated experience administrating/monitoring Kubernetes clusters
  • Experience with IaC (Infrastructure as Code) principles and automation infrastructure provisioning and configuration using tools such as Helm and Ansible
  • Demonstrated experience using system monitoring tools such as Prometheus/Grafana
  • Experience with Git for source code management, branching strategies, and team collaboration
